JDK-8078999 : [macosx] Few ShapedAndTranslucentWindows test fails for Mac 10.10 but passes for 10.9
  • Type: Bug
  • Component: client-libs
  • Sub-Component: java.awt
  • Affected Version: 9,14
  • Priority: P4
  • Status: Open
  • Resolution: Unresolved
  • OS: linux,os_x,windows
  • CPU: generic
  • Submitted: 2015-04-29
  • Updated: 2020-02-20
The Version table provides details related to the release that this issue/RFE will be addressed.

Unresolved : Release in which this issue/RFE will be addressed.
Resolved: Release in which this issue/RFE has been resolved.
Fixed : Release in which this issue/RFE has been fixed. The release containing this fix may be available for download as an Early Access Release or a General Availability Release.

To download the current JDK release, click here.
Other
tbdUnresolved
Related Reports
Relates :  
Relates :  
Description
Test name(s):
java/awt/Window/ShapedAndTranslucentWindows/Shaped.java
java/awt/Window/ShapedAndTranslucentWindows/ShapedByAPI.java
java/awt/Window/ShapedAndTranslucentWindows/ShapedTranslucent.java
java/awt/Window/ShapedAndTranslucentWindows/StaticallyShaped.java

JDK tested: 9b60
OS tested: Mac 10.10 ,Mac10.9
Is it a regression? NO 
Is it platform specific? Yes (fails on Mac10.9)
The is failure reproduced: always 
    
General description: 
----------System.out:(0/0)----------
----------System.err:(16/1204)----------
java.lang.RuntimeException: Background point java.awt.Point[x=282,y=282] color java.awt.Color[r=0,g=0,b=250] does not equal to background color java.awt.Color[r=0,g=0,b=255]
	at Common.checkShape(Common.java:265)
	at Common.checkDynamicShape(Common.java:243)
	at Shaped.doTest(Shaped.java:70)
	at Shaped.main(Shaped.java:55)
	at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
	at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:62)
	at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
	at java.lang.reflect.Method.invoke(Method.java:502)
	at com.sun.javatest.regtest.agent.MainWrapper$MainThread.run(MainWrapper.java:92)
	at java.lang.Thread.run(Thread.java:745)

JavaTest Message: Test threw exception: java.lang.RuntimeException: Background point java.awt.Point[x=282,y=282] color java.awt.Color[r=0,g=0,b=250] does not equal to background color java.awt.Color[r=0,g=0,b=255]
JavaTest Message: shutting down test

STATUS:Failed.`main' threw exception: java.lang.RuntimeException: Background point java.awt.Point[x=282,y=282] color java.awt.Color[r=0,g=0,b=250] does not equal to background color java.awt.Color[r=0,g=0,b=255]

Comments
This test timesout in windows10 and ubuntu18.04 during PIT
11-04-2019

Actual picked color and indeed exact coordinate may vary: there's no sense to keep it in the rule RULE "java/awt/Window/ShapedAndTranslucentWindows/Shaped.java" Exception java.lang.RuntimeException: Background point java.awt.Point[x=...,y=...] color java.awt.Color[r=0,g=0,b=...] does not equal to background color java.awt.Color[r=0,g=0,b=255] RULE "java/awt/Window/ShapedAndTranslucentWindows/ShapedByAPI.java" Exception java.lang.RuntimeException: Background point java.awt.Point[x=...,y=...] color java.awt.Color[r=0,g=0,b=...] does not equal to background color java.awt.Color[r=0,g=0,b=255] RULE "java/awt/Window/ShapedAndTranslucentWindows/ShapedTranslucent.java" Exception java.lang.RuntimeException: Background point java.awt.Point[x=...,y=...] color java.awt.Color[r=0,g=0,b=...] does not equal to background color java.awt.Color[r=0,g=0,b=255] RULE "java/awt/Window/ShapedAndTranslucentWindows/StaticallyShaped.java" Exception java.lang.RuntimeException: Background point java.awt.Point[x=327,y=273] color java.awt.Color[r=0,g=0,b=217] does not equal to background color java.awt.Color[r=0,g=0,b=255]
05-08-2016

RULE "java/awt/Window/ShapedAndTranslucentWindows/Shaped.java" Exception java.lang.RuntimeException: Background point java.awt.Point[x=264,y=363] color java.awt.Color[r=0,g=0,b=248] does not equal to background color java.awt.Color[r=0,g=0,b=255] RULE "java/awt/Window/ShapedAndTranslucentWindows/StaticallyShaped.java" Exception java.lang.RuntimeException: Background point java.awt.Point[x=304,y=398] color java.awt.Color[r=0,g=0,b=217] does not equal to background color java.awt.Color[r=0,g=0,b=255]
26-11-2015

RULE java/awt/Window/ShapedAndTranslucentWindows/StaticallyShaped.java Exception java.lang.RuntimeException: Background point java.awt.Point[x=227,y=227] color java.awt.Color[r=0,g=10,b=207] does not equal to background color java.awt.Color[r=0,g=0,b=255]
06-08-2015

RULE java/awt/Window/ShapedAndTranslucentWindows/Shaped.java Exception java.lang.RuntimeException: Background point java.awt.Point[x=314,y=367] color java.awt.Color[r=0,g=0,b=247] does not equal to background color java.awt.Color[r=0,g=0,b=255] RULE java/awt/Window/ShapedAndTranslucentWindows/ShapedByAPI.java Exception java.lang.RuntimeException: Background point java.awt.Point[x=358,y=311] color java.awt.Color[r=0,g=0,b=209] does not equal to background color java.awt.Color[r=0,g=0,b=255]
11-06-2015

RULE java/awt/Window/ShapedAndTranslucentWindows/ShapedByAPI.java Exception java.lang.RuntimeException: Background point java.awt.Point[x=282,y=282] color java.awt.Color[r=0,g=0,b=250] does not equal to background color java.awt.Color[r=0,g=0,b=255]
14-05-2015

RULE java/awt/Window/ShapedAndTranslucentWindows/ShapedByAPI.java Exception java.lang.RuntimeException: Background point java.awt.Point[x=309,y=341] color java.awt.Color[r=0,g=0,b=248] does not equal to background color java.awt.Color[r=0,g=0,b=255]
07-05-2015